Unworthy

unworthy
 adjective  Date: 13th century  1.  a. lacking in excellence or value ; poor, worthless  b. base, dishonorable  2. not meritorious ; undeserving ~ of attention  3. not deserved ; unmerited ~ treatment  4. inappropriate to one's condition or station actions ~ of a gentleman  • unworthily adverb  • unworthiness noun

  1. If a person or thing is unworthy of something good, they do not deserve it. He felt unworthy of being married to such an attractive woman. ? worthy ADJ: oft ADJ of n/-ing, ADJ to-inf 2. If you say that an action is unworthy of someone, you mean that it is not a nice thing to do and someone with their reputation or position should not do it. (LITERARY) His accusations are unworthy of a prime minister. ADJ: oft ADJ of n ...
